Constantin Esarcu (5 November 1836 8 June 1898) was a naturalist, physician, teacher, politician and diplomat who served as the Minister of Foreign Affairs of Kingdom of Romania from 21 February until 26 November 1891.

Quick facts Minister of Foreign Affairs of Kingdom of Romania, Monarch ...

Esarcu graduated from a university in Bucharest and Sorbonne University in Paris. In 1864, he received his doctoral degree in medicine. He also served as the Romanian ambassador to France.[1] In 1884, he was elected a corresponding member of the Romanian Academy.[2]

He died on 8 June 1898 in Govora, Mihăești, Vâlcea.
